Soaring Eagle Casino is one such destination that embodies the spirit of Native American gaming. As an enterprise owned by the Saginaw Chippewa Indian Tribe, it offers a vast array of entertainment options while honoring its cultural roots. With over 4,000 slots, 65 table games, and various other activities, Soaring Eagle Casino provides an engaging environment for players to indulge in.
How the Concept Works
Native American gaming often works hand-in-hand with state or federal regulations governing the gaming industry. In this context, the casino operates as a sovereign nation within its own jurisdictional boundaries, subject to both tribal and government laws. The tribe’s self-regulation policies are aimed at maintaining social responsibility while ensuring the economic viability of their business ventures.
